 JEE Main 2026 Session 2 Final Answer Key Released

The National Testing Agency has released the final answer key for JEE Main 2026 Session 2. Candidates who appeared for the exam from April 2 to April 8, 2026 can now download the answer key from the official website jeemain.nta.nic.in. With the final answer key now available, the JEE Main 2026 result is expected to be declared anytime soon, likely on April 20, 2026, along with category-wise cutoff percentiles and All India Rank (AIR).

JEE Main 2026 Session 2 Key Dates:

Event Date
JEE Main 2026 Session 2 Exam April 2 – April 8, 2026
Provisional Answer Key Released April 11, 2026
Answer Key Challenge Window Closed April 13, 2026
Final Answer Key Release April 2026
Result Declaration (Expected) April 20, 2026
JEE Advanced Eligibility Announcement After result
How to calculate score using JEE Main marking scheme?

The official marking scheme is as follows:

  • +4 marks for each correct answer
  • -1 mark for each incorrect answer
  • 0 marks for unanswered questions

The answer key also includes numerical value questions with correct answers. After calculating raw scores, candidates should note that final scores are determined using normalisation and percentile calculation, which may slightly change the final result.

Candidates will be able to download their scorecards using their login credentials, and the result will also indicate their eligibility for the next stage. Those who meet the cutoff will be eligible to appear for JEE Advanced, with the top 2.5 lakh candidates across all categories qualifying for the exam, which serves as the gateway to admission in IITs. Additionally, qualified candidates can participate in JoSAA counselling for admission to NITs, IIITs, and other centrally funded technical institutions.
